HUGGINS, After William John (1781-1845)
H.C.S. Macqueen off the Start, 26th. January 1832
London: Published by W.J. Huggins, 1834. Colour-printed aquatint, finished by hand, by C. Rosenberg after Huggins. Sheet size: 16 x 21 inches.
A fine image of an East-Indiaman making sail.
William Huggins served for several years at sea in the service of the East India Compnay, and on his return to London was regularly employed to paint carefully detailed pictures of the company's ships. The present image is from this body of work and shows the Honourable Company Ship Macqueen making sail in crowded waters (12 other vessels are visible).
